GRAHAM SUTHERLAND GRAHAM SUTHERLAND was born in London on August 24th, 1903. The first nine years of his life were spent at Merton Park, Surrey, and at Rustington, in Sussex. In 1912 he went to boarding school at Sutton; and it is from this time, during some holidays spent at Swanage, that he himself dates that mysterious intimacy with Nature which has since developed into the basis of his art?its raison d'etre. I say "mysterious" advisedly, for there is nothing so occult, so removed from usual understanding, as the interaction of two planes of life: the human being on the one hand, on the other all that vast theory of organisms, from stones to trees, in which the characteristic movement of life is not adjusted to our vision; so that we can only feel it, if we be exceptionally sensitive, or perceive it at most in that immobility?ominous or serene or merely intense?which is like that of the gyroscope a-spin. In childhood this experience of "inanimate objects"kas living with a life that is both like and unlike our own, is common to all of us, because the younger the human being the less distinct are the senses one from another, so that what is perceived at all tends to be experienced by the whole body at once. But in adults the faculty of retaining this .valuable intuition of Essence is the prerogative of artists, though not all of them care to use it. In Graham Sutherland, however, the experience was too constant and too vivid to be obliterated: the luscious pastures and leafage in the neighbourhood of Rustington, the whites and silver greens of the country behind Swanage, stepped down out of the background, so to speak, and offered themselves to a pair of eyes that were henceforward to act as a powerful magnifying glass to every grass and leaf, every wrinkle in an old tree-stump.
